The Argentine president apologized to the Pope

Argentine President Javier Milei has apologized to Pope Francis for previously calling him "a representative of the most harmful on Earth."

Axar.az reports that the portal published information about this.

"I want to apologize to you for my past statements," Milei said during her meeting with the Pope in the Vatican.

According to the Argentine leader, his statements were a youthful mistake.

The conversation between the Pope and Miley lasted about an hour, and at the end of the meeting mutual gifts were given.
